HERMES (RRID:SCR_009584) HERMES data processing software, software application, software resource, software toolkit A toolbox for the Matlab environment designed to study functional and effective brain connectivity from neurophysiological data such as multivariate EEG and/or MEG records. It includes also visualization tools and statistical methods to address the problem of multiple comparisons. DTI Fiber Tract Statistics (RRID:SCR_009460) DTI Fiber Tract Statistics data processing software, software application, software resource, image analysis software This is a command line tool which allows the user to study the behavior of water diffusion (using DTI data) along the length of the white matter fiber-tracts. Various tract-oriented scalar diffusion measures obtained from DTI brain images, are treated as a continuous function of white matter fibers'' arc-length. To analyze the trend along a given fiber tract, a command line tool performs kernel regression on this data. The idea is to try out different noise models and maximum likelihood estimates within kernel windows (along the tract), such that they best represent the data and are robust to noise and Partial Volume effect. The package contains several command line based modules and an GUI based tool called DTIAtlasFiberAnalyzer to access most functions. The features available in the tool currently, its use and input / output formats and other relevant details are provided in the first draft of the documentation. AutoSeg (RRID:SCR_009438) AutoSeg data processing software, software application, software resource, image analysis software A novel C++ based application developped at UNC-Chapel Hill that performs automatic brain tissue classification and structural segmentation. AutoSeg is designed for use with human and non-human primate pediatric, adolescent and adult data. AutoSeg uses a BatchMake pipeline script that includes the main steps of the framework entailing N4 bias field correction, rigid registration to a common coordinate image, tissue segmentation, skull-stripping, intensity rescaling, atlas-based registration, subcortical segmentation and lobar parcellation, regional cortical thickness and intensity statistics. 7T Structural MRI scans ATAG (RRID:SCR_014084) data set, data or information resource, atlas Data sets from the atlasing of the basal ganglia (ATAG) consortium, which provides ultra-high resolution 7Tesla (T) mag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scans from young, middle-aged, and elderly participants. They include whole-brain and reduced field-of-view MP2RAGE and T2 scans with ultra-high resolution at a sub millimeter scale. The data can be used to develop new algorithms that help building new high-resolution atlases both in the basic and clinical neurosciences. ERP PCA Toolkit (RRID:SCR_013105) ERP PCA Toolkit data processing software, software application, software resource, software toolkit This Matlab toolkit is a general purpose tool for editing, visualizing, and analyzing EEG data (both Event Related Potential - ERP and spectral) whose most recent version has been downloaded over 1000 times. Its three chief highlights are: 1) an optimized automatic artifact correction function that includes ICA correction for eye blinks and saccades. 2) Extensive support for easily conducting PCA and ICA through all stages of the procedure, including inspection of reconstituted waveforms and batch ANOVAs. 3) Implementation of robust ANOVAs, including McCarthy-Wood vector test. It has a graphical user interface for point and click usage and comes with an extensive illustrated tutorial. A description of the toolkit was published in Dien (2010) in Journal of Neuroscience Methods. GSA-SNP (RRID:SCR_013109) GSA-SNP data processing software, software application, software resource A tool for the gene-set (or pathway) analysis of a genome-wide association study result. It accepts a genome-wide list of SNPs and their association P-values. It summarizes the SNP P-values into nearby genes. The gene-by-gene summary results are then further summarized by gene-sets such as Gene Ontology, KEGG pathways, or user-created gene-sets. Various standardization and statistical tests can be performed and the resulting gene-sets that pass a significance level after multiple-testing correction are reported.
